Aluminium Chloride Formula

Aluminium trichloride or aluminium (III) chloride are other names for aluminium chloride. When aluminium and chlorine combine together, the chemical is created. AlCl 3 is the chemical formula for it. When it comes to aesthetics, aluminium chloride is often white. It takes on a yellowish colour due to the presence of impurities (iron(III) chloride). Aluminium chloride is used to make aluminium metal in industry, but it also has a variety of functions in the chemical industry, primarily as a Lewis acid. Covalently bound solid aluminium chloride (AlCl 3 ) has a low melting and boiling temperature. AlCl3 lewis structure, molecular geometry, bond angle, polarity, electrons

Aluminum chloride is composed of aluminum and chloride also known as aluminum trichloride or aluminum (III) chloride having the chemical formula AlCl3. It appears as white to gray powder with a pungent odor. In solution forms, it appears as a straw-colored liquid. It is mostly used in the production of aluminum metals. In this tutorial, we will study Aluminum chloride (AlCl3) lewis structure, molecular geometry, hybridization, polarity, bond angle, etc. Aluminum chloride is corrosive to tissue and toxic by ingestion. It is powerful lewis acid and capable of reversible changing from polymer to monomer at mild temperature. It sometimes appears yellowish in color due to the presence of contaminants. Properties of Aluminium chloride • • It has a molar mass of 133.341 g/mol. • It appears as white or pale yellow solid. • It has a melting point of 180 °C. • It has a low melting and boiling point. • It is non-flammable and powerful lewis acid. • It has a coordinate geometry of octahedral in the solid phase and tetrahedral in the liquid phase. Name of Molecule Aluminum chloride Chemical formula AlCl3 Molecular geometry of AlCl3 Trigonal planar Electron geometry of AlCl3 Trigonal planar Hybridization Sp 2 Nature Non-polar molecule Total Valence electron for AlCl3 24 In the AlCl3 lewis structure, there is one atom of aluminum (Al) and three atoms of chlorine (Cl).
